ALIEN CONTROL

Work Of Classification

Al'l'.'ingi'ini'iils lor teinporary a.s.-isl-.•ini'e with the .-liissi lie.-i I ion in Writing' ton of aliens under tile Aliens Emergency Itognl;iI ions wer : announced yeslerd.'iy by Hie Minisier of .Inst ice. Mr. Mason. He said Unit to avoid delay in the classification lli.'il might result from Hie appoinlnient of Mr. .lustice Uallan to preside over the Commission of Inquiry recently set up by the Government to investigate the recent shipping losses through enemy action, it had been decided to ask Mr. G. I’. Finlay, solicitor, Auckland, to come to Wellington to assist with this work, and that he had already taken up the duty. Mr. Finlay is the Aliens Authority in Auckland, but, because the classification of all enemy aliens in the Auckland district was now completed, his services had become available for the Wellington work
